Sepals and petals are referred to as "accessory parts" because they are not directly involved in the reproductive processes of the flower. Instead, they serve supportive roles, such as protecting the reproductive organs and attracting pollinators. While essential for the flower's overall function and success, they do not contribute to the formation of seeds or fruit, which are produced by the reproductive structures like stamens and carpels.

Why are the sepals and petals referred to as accessory parts of a plant?

Sepals and petals are referred to as accessory parts of a plant because they do not play a direct role in reproduction. Instead, sepals typically protect the developing flower bud, while petals attract pollinators through their color and shape. Together, they support the reproductive structures, such as stamens and carpels, but are not essential for the plant's reproductive process. Thus, they are considered non-essential, or accessory, components of the flower.
